The result we get when we divide one number by another number is called the quotient. The quotient is a whole number or a decimal, depending on the numbers involved. We will learn about the quotient of 7/49 below.
To find the quotient of 7 ÷ 49, we can follow the steps given below. These steps make the division process simple.
Step 1: Write the number with a decimal point. So 7 will become 7.000.
Step 2: Recognize that 49 is not a power of ten, so we'll perform standard division.
Step 3: Divide 7 by 49 using long division or a calculator. 7 ÷ 49 = 0.142857.
Step 4: Verify by multiplying the quotient by 49: 0.142857 × 49 ≈ 7, confirming the result is correct.
